Recognizing the Variety Of Roof Services Available: From Expert Installment to Reliable Repairs and Upkeep Steering the intricacies of roof services is important for property owners. Different products use distinct benefits, and recognizing these choices can inform much better decisions. Installment processes differ by material, and knowing what to expect https://roofrepair12185.wikigiogio.com/1908841/discover_how_roof_installation_temecula_enhances_comfort